The two’s destination was in the eastern suburbs of Furong River City, a villa district near the city’s nursing home, but even though it was outside the city, the price of the villas was probably not low.
"Is your classmate’s family very wealthy, or is dog breeding very profitable?" Wen Wen asked, turning his head.
From the parked vehicles, it was evident that the residents here were either rich or noble, yet her classmate was using such a place for dog breeding?
"I haven’t heard that his family is very wealthy, but he has bragged to me that they rented the villa very cheaply, which is probably because there was something wrong with that house, making it so affordable," Jiao Xinlei thought for a moment before replying.
Wen Wen nodded, took note of this point, and continued driving.
After driving for a while, Jiao Xinlei suddenly pointed ahead and said to Wen Wen, "Hey, isn’t that Wen Yue up front? She seems very sad. Stop the car for a moment; I’ll get out and check on her."
Up ahead on the road, a sixteen or seventeen-year-old girl, dragging a suitcase and wearing an orange tracksuit, walked alone with her head down.
Wen Wen stopped the car, and Jiao Xinlei went up to her, intending to ask about the situation.
...
Jiang Wenyue dragged her suitcase, sobbing as she walked.
She just couldn’t stand that home any longer, with all sorts of strange occurrences happening one after another. It was as if there weren’t just the four of them in the house, but countless people hiding in corners, watching their every move.
Opening a cabinet sometimes revealed a fleeting face, turning on the light momentarily showed a blurred shadow, and there seemed to always be someone else present in the cramped bathroom...
And that dog, it had been getting stranger and stranger lately!
Even if their family moved away, those eerie events would still follow them like shadows, so she decided not to stay at home anymore.
She had contacted a classmate who said she could stay with them for a few days, hoping it would spare her further mental torment.
As she walked by the roadside, she suddenly saw ahead Jiao Xinlei and a strange man waving at her.
She recognized Jiao Xinlei, who was close to her brother, and at one point thought she might become her sister-in-law.
But that man...
He made her feel very uneasy, and for a moment, she thought Wen Wen was like those things in her house. Could it be that those things could appear even in broad daylight?
Jiang Wenyue, terrified out of her wits, abandoned her suitcase and started to run in the opposite direction.
She had actually been on the verge of collapse for some time now.
"Hey, what’s wrong with this kid? It’s like she’s seen something terrifying."
Jiao Xinlei glanced suspiciously at Wen Wen. He did look quite frightening at a glance, and with Jiang Wenyue’s current mental state being possibly unstable, it wasn’t impossible that Wen Wen had scared her.
Suddenly, Jiang Wenyue fell flat on the ground, tumbling onto the roadway and unable to get up!
In an instant, she couldn’t rise to her feet!
Jiao Xinlei hurried over to try and help Jiang Wenyue up. There weren’t many cars on this road, so an accident seemed unlikely...
No sooner had this thought crossed her mind than Jiao Xinlei’s heart leapt, because a private car was driving toward Jiang Wenyue’s direction. There was enough distance to stop, but the approaching vehicle showed no signs of halting!
Jiang Wenyue, lying on the ground, unable to get up, wore a look of despair. She feared her life would end here.
Perhaps dying would not be so bad; at least she would no longer suffer.
Suddenly, someone grabbed her by the collar, and she was tossed onto the pedestrian walkway. The man who saved her was the same man in the black coat she’d just seen!
That man stood still, not dodging, as the car raced toward him.
"Is this man going to be hit by a car to save me..." Jiang Wenyue’s mind flashed through countless soap opera scenarios, and then she felt moved by her own thoughts.
Wen Wen squinted, watching the approaching car.
The driver’s eyes were somewhat hazy; clearly, he was unaware of what was ahead.
"Ha... what a hassle."
Just as he was about to be hit by the car, Wen Wen sighed, placed his hand on the hood, pressed hard, and leveraged himself to jump right over the roof!
Jiang Wenyue and Jiao Xinlei both widened their eyes as if they had seen a superhero.
Pressed hard by Wen Wen, the car shook violently, and the driver sobered up, stopped the car, rolled down the window, and stuck his head out to curse at Wen Wen.
"What the hell are you doing standing in the middle of the road, looking for death? If you haven’t lived enough, go jump in a river!" Most drivers were somewhat irritable on the road.
Wen Wen’s expression turned inconvenient, and he walked over, grabbed the driver’s hair, and rubbed it back and forth against the window until the driver’s face was scraped raw.
"What... why are you hitting me?" The driver slurred his words, his whole face burning with pain.
"There are countless rules on the road, safety is the top priority, careless driving will bring tears to your family."
Wen Wen said earnestly, "You were driving drunk, so I’m teaching you a lesson on behalf of your parents!"
"Yes, yes, it was my fault."
The driver nodded in agreement, quickly softened up, and after driving the car five or six meters away said, "You just wait for me, I..."
Before he could finish his sentence, Wen Wen grabbed his hair again. The driver’s eyes widened in disbelief, looking at Wen Wen. He had planned that the moment Wen Wen made a move, he’d step on the gas and leave—how could Wen Wen be so fast?
"You still have eighteen generations of ancestors, do you need me to teach you a lesson on their behalf?" Wen Wen said with a good-natured tone.
"No more, no more," the driver quickly waved his hands.
Wen Wen let go, and the driver drove off obediently, not daring to speak harshly anymore.
The driver had been drinking, but it was likely just a small drink; it wasn’t possible that he couldn’t see the pedestrians on the road clearly. The reason why he drove straight into them was probably due to some kind of bewitchment.
Wen Wen’s actions just now had sobered up the driver, otherwise, in his state, he might have caused another car accident.
So, Wen Wen beating him was for his own good.
Yeah, that was definitely it.
"You were still behind me just now, how did you rescue Wen Yue so quickly?" Jiao Xinlei asked Wen Wen in amazement.
"Detectives run fast, that’s normal," Wen Wen crouched in front of Jiang Wenyue, squinting as he looked her over.
"How did you manage to pick someone up with one hand and throw them like that!" She didn’t believe Wen Wen’s explanation.
"Detectives are strong, that’s normal," Wen Wen replied dismissively, still staring at Jiang Wenyue.
"Well, okay, you’re a detective, that’s normal." Jiao Xinlei was about to ask how Wen Wen jumped from the car, but she guessed what his answer would be and stopped herself.
Wen Wen continued staring at Jiang Wenyue, making the high school girl feel somewhat embarrassed. Being looked at like this by her savior made her shy.
"Um... how much longer do you need to look?" Jiang Wenyue asked softly.
"Oh, sorry, I was deep in thought." Wen Wen withdrew his gaze and pointed at Jiang Wenyue’s leg, saying, "Take off your pants."
Jiang Wenyue: "???"
Jiao Xinlei: "???"
Even if it’s the classic hero saving the beauty, and the beauty offering herself in gratitude, you’re rushing things a bit too much!
"What are you doing, she’s just a child!" Jiao Xinlei exclaimed, pushing Wen Wen away.
Wen Wen explained, "I’m not going to do anything, just looking at your leg."
Both women’s expressions turned even more quizzical—it sounded like he was saying, "I’m just going to rub it, not put it in..."
"Ah, you women, why are your thoughts so dirty?"
Wen Wen sighed, knowing that some things just can’t be explained with words.
He reached out directly, grabbed Jiang Wenyue’s leg, took out a small knife from his embrace, and cut open a section of her pant leg.
Seeing this scene, both women closed their mouths.
Because on Jiang Wenyue’s pristine white leg, there was a startling black handprint...
It was a human palm print!
